How to Deactivate Wi-Fi Temporarily on Windows, macOS, and Mobile Devices

To temporarily deactivate Wi-Fi, you can follow these steps: On Windows, go to Settings > Network & Internet > Wi-Fi and toggle off the switch. On macOS, click the Wi-Fi icon on the menu bar and select 'Turn Wi-Fi Off.' For mobile devices, swipe down the notification shade and tap the Wi-Fi icon to disable it. Reactivating Wi-Fi is as simple as toggling the switch back on.
